How it works

  1. Cast Gravecrawler either from your hand or graveyard by paying B mana.
  2. When Gravecrawler enters the battlefield, Aunt May, Carnival of Souls and The Sibsig Ceremony trigger.
  3. Resolve the Aunt May trigger, causing you to gain 1 life.
  4. Resolve the Carnival of Souls trigger, causing you to lose 1 life and add B mana.
  5. Resolve the Sibsig Ceremony trigger, destroying Gravecrawler and creating a 2/2 Zombie Druid creature token.
  6. When the Zombie Druid enters the battlefield, Aunt May and Carnival of Souls trigger.
  7. Resolve the Aunt May trigger, causing you to gain 1 life.
  8. Resolve the Carnival of Souls trigger, causing you to lose 1 life and add B mana.
  9. Repeat.

This loop is a masterclass in recycling, fueled by The Sibsig Ceremony making your creature spells cost {2} less so you can recast Gravecrawler from your graveyard for a mere single black mana as long as you control a Zombie. Each time Gravecrawler enters, Carnival of Souls provides the mana to sustain the loop while paying for the life loss with life gained from Aunt May's watchful care. Finally, The Sibsig Ceremony steps in to immediately destroy the recursive Skeleton and leave behind a fresh 2/2 black Zombie Druid token, which in turn keeps your Zombie-requirement satisfied and continuously triggers both Aunt May and Carnival of Souls all over again.
